Labels to Help Track Your Rocks

Here's an easy way to help track any rocks you "hide". This helps whoever finds your rock to post it back here. I've used these in other groups and the messages I see when someone "finds" a rock that made their whole day fill the heart. The URL points back to this sub.

These are full sheets of 70 labels each. Just print & cut along the dashed lines. Each label is 1" x 1". If you need smaller, use the zoom out function on the printer.

To use, glue it to the bottom of the rock. I use Elmer's purple school glue (dries clear). Make sure the whole label bottom has glue to protect it from moisture.
Do this before you do any clear coat. If you don't use a clear coat, then use more glue to coat the top of the label.

There's 2 versions. A color and a B&W. The color is prettier, the B&W is cheaper. The B&W is also best for B&W laser printers. They are free to use and download.

FYI: I see some inkjets will smear when the clear coat is applied. You may have to print these at Office Depot, FedEx Office, or a UPS Store instead.
